Basement Foundation Sealing in Birmingham, AL
Basement foundation sealing services involve applying specialized materials to the exterior or interior of a basement’s foundation walls to prevent water infiltration and reduce moisture issues. These projects typically include sealing cracks, joints, and vulnerable areas to create a waterproof barrier, which helps protect the property from water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ration caused by moisture intrusion. Homeowners often seek this service when experiencing basement leaks, dampness, or increased humidity, especially in regions prone to heavy rainfall or high groundwater levels.

Basement Foundation Sealing Questions
What is basement foundation sealing? Basement foundation sealing involves applying protective materials to prevent water intrusion and moisture buildup in the basement area.
Why should homeowners consider sealing their basement foundation? Sealing helps protect against water damage, mold growth, and structural issues caused by moisture infiltration.
What types of projects typically require foundation sealing? Projects include addressing existing leaks, preventing future water intrusion, and improving basement dryness and stability.
How does foundation sealing improve a property's condition? It enhances moisture control, reduces potential damage, and helps maintain a dry, stable basement environment.
